How to Identify Authentic Organic Cotton Products

How to Identify Authentic Organic Cotton Products

When exploring the world of sustainable fashion, particularly in the realm of organic cotton, it’s crucial to know how to identify authentic products. One of the key indicators of genuine organic cotton is the presence of natural specks, which can often be seen within the fibers of the fabric. These specks are the remnants of the cotton plant’s organic processes, a testament to the lack of synthetic additives or treatments that are prevalent in conventional cotton production. Authentic organic cotton is not only grown without harmful pesticides or fertilizers, but the fibers themselves retain some elements of the unprocessed plant, showcasing their natural origins. Additionally, certified products will typically bear labels such as G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ard), ensuring not only sustainable farming practices but also ethical production methods. When shopping for organic cotton, look for these natural specks as a sign of authenticity, and always check for certifications to ensure that you are supporting eco-friendly and socially responsible fashion.

What are the natural specks found in organic cotton?

The natural specks in organic cotton are remnants of the cotton plant, such as seed coating or leaves, which were not removed during the processing. These specks are a sign that the cotton is unrefined and has undergone minimal chemical treatment.

How can I tell if the organic cotton product I’m purchasing is authentic?

To ensure authenticity, look for certification labels such as G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ard) or OEKO-TEX. Additionally, examine the product for natural variations, such as specks and color differences, which indicate a non-chemical production process.

Why is certification important in organic cotton?

Certification is crucial because it ensures that the cotton has been grown and processed according to strict organic standards. This helps consumers trust that they are purchasing genuine organic products free from harmful chemicals and environmentally destructive practices.

What should consumers be aware of when purchasing organic cotton products?

Consumers should be aware of the certification processes and look for reputable brands that prioritize genuine organic practices. Additionally, understanding the presence of natural specks as a sign of authenticity can help them make informed purchasing decisions.

Are all cotton products with natural specks necessarily organic?

Not necessarily. While natural specks can indicate a lesser degree of processing commonly associated with organic cotton, it’s essential to verify the product’s certification to ensure it meets organic standards.
